The Lane County Historical Society Museum offers a variety of collections drawn from local artifacts that interpret the history of Eugene and surrounding communities. The organization also offers special exhibits and programs throughout the year and a digital library of photographs, manuscripts, and other sources for historians and genealogists.

This small museum and historical society is staffed by several full-time historians and archivists and offers exhibits and activities throughout the year within this complex of historic and reconstructed buildings. The organization is dedicated to collecting and preserving artifacts and library materials related to county history. It is operated by the Lane County Historical Society. The museum's collections range from the early 1800s to the present. They are comprised of photographs, manuscripts, maps and books, newspaper clippings, and studies and reports. The society's long-term goal is to open a history center, one that would house the museum and other organizations.
